**Runbook 6.3 — Account Recovery, Fanstream Backpressure Controller.** Support team: if the Fanstream operator account is disabled, notification fan-out loses its backpressure limits and queues can overrun within minutes. Pause upstream publishers first. Then restore the operator account via the Marrowgate console, which verifies identity before re-enabling throttles. The console requires the recovery passphrase recorded below.

recovery phrase for tawef-hawif: praiel-novvan-frador-soriel-novath-pelath

Auditscope, our audit-log viewer, runs in three environments: sandbox, staging, and production. Each environment reads from its own immutable log store, and retention windows differ — sandbox purges after seven days, production never purges. Future maintainers should note that the viewer's query layer is read-only by design; any write path is a bug. Staging mirrors production schemas but uses synthetic events generated nightly by the Fablemill seeder. The staging instance currently uses the following configuration values.

settings of baweg-tadup:
[julwyn]
host = julwyn.novacdata.internal
user = julwyn_svc
database = julwyn_prod

**Ticket: Config drift on BounceSift processor**

The email bounce processor in the Larkfield environment has drifted from the values committed in the release branch. Retry windows and suppression thresholds no longer match, which likely explains the duplicate suppression entries reported Tuesday. Please reconcile before the Thursday cut. For reference, the currently deployed configuration on the live node reads as follows.

config for yajep-yahof:
[briax]
port = 9200
region = outer-2
host = briax.nelvrocorp.test
team = raleth
timeout_ms = 1500
retries = 1